Disable State Unemployment Tax for Exempt Organization

I'm setting up payroll for a company that is exempt from State Unemployment, but it's not giving me the option to select exempt or turn off state unemployment. Any tips on how to solve this issue?

Disable State Unemployment Tax for Exempt Organization

Hello there, Sarah. Let me walk you through the steps to exempt a company from State Unemployment Insurance (SUI) taxes in QuickBooks Online (QBO).

 

To exempt a company from SUI taxes, you'll have to go through each employee and exempt them individually. Here's how:

 

  1. Go to Payroll and click Employees.
  2. Select the employee.
  3. From the Tax Withholding section, click Edit.
  4. In the Tax Exemptions dropdown, put a checkmark on the SUI box.
  5. Click Save, then Done.

 

However, if you don't have these options, it's possible that there's a temporary problem with the browser. Let's isolate the issue by accessing your account in an incognito window. Here are some keyboard shortcuts:

 

  • For Google Chrome browser: Ctrl + Shift + N
  • For Mozilla Firefox browser: Ctrl + Shift + P
  • For Safari browser: Command + Shift + N

 

Then, refer to the steps above. Once resolved, you can return to your regular browser to clear its cache. You may also opt to switch to another compatible one.
